Output fd81ba75d374408ab83e304176c0d1c10743bc53888d29a7dd6de8575be5d072:0

value
108164
script pubkey
OP_0 OP_PUSHBYTES_20 d0139b2d29c6270e16f9831e4ed27ee68ca7e906
address
bc1q6qfektffccnsu9hesv0ya5n7u6x206gx8m3pwq
transaction
fd81ba75d374408ab83e304176c0d1c10743bc53888d29a7dd6de8575be5d072
spent
true